Career Planning & Placement, Senior Manager Overview

  • Person Group: Professional
  • Job Code: 75400
  • Pay Grade: P9
  • FLSA Status: Exempt
  • Career Level: Senior Manager
  • Family: Student Services
  • Function: Career Planning & Placement

Purpose

Support and help students prepare and compete for experiential learning opportunities, professional employment, and graduate and professional school opportunities by working closely with college faculty and administration to embed career related learning outcomes into the classroom, designing and managing out of classroom career education opportunities, and through coaching/advising students on career exploration, planning, and the job search.

Level Scope

Spends the majority of time (50% or more) achieving organizational objectives through the coordinated achievements of subordinate staff. Manages experienced professionals who exercise latitude and independence in assignments. Establishes departmental goals and objectives, functions with autonomy. Manages the accountability and stewardship of human, financial, and often physical resources in compliance with departmental and campus wide goals and objectives. Ensures subordinate supervisors and professionals adhere to defined internal controls with a focus on policy and strategy implementation. Manages systems and procedures to protect departmental assets and requires practical knowledge in leading and managing the execution of processes, projects and tactics within one area.

Minimum Qualifications

Bachelor’s degree or relevant experience plus 5 years experience including 1 year managerial experience

Essential Functions

Key Responsibilities

60% of Time the Career Planning & Placement, Senior Manager must:

  • Design, coordinate, and deliver career curriculum to educate all students about career paths; engage them in experiential learning opportunities and career planning; prepare them for their job search; and connect them with potential employers
  • Establish and maintain successful relationships with colleagues in order to lead people toward a common vision of supporting student career readiness
  • Manage efforts to deliver inclusive career services to students in order to build a culture of career readiness in each college
  • Design and lead innovative career programming by applying knowledge of diverse identities, generational traits, student interests, and unique student needs related to career education
  • Create and deliver effective workshops, presentations, and programming on career-related topics
